- Alert), a provider of next-generation network access solutions for the mobile enterprise, recently announced that Wi-Fi Alliance has selected the company’s wireless LAN products for the Wi-Fi CERTIFIED Passpoint test bed.
Wi-Fi Alliance (News - Alert) recently expanded its important Wi-Fi CERTIFIED Passpoint program. Now, in addition to seamless connection and WPA2 security for mobile devices in Wi-Fi hotspots, Passpoint provides a streamlined method to establish new user accounts and connect Wi-Fi-only devices such as tablets and notebooks. The new features in Passpoint expand the program's strategic value to mobile and fixed operators, and open opportunities for other sectors as they invest in Wi-Fi to meet business challenges.
As per the agreement, Aruba products, including 3600 Mobility Controllers, AP-105 Access Points (APs) and the Online Sign-Up (OSU) policy server, will be supporting newer capabilities of the Wi-Fi Alliance Passpoint test bed.
